    Festival of the Lion King Moves and AVATAR Land Construction Begin 2014

    Disney today officially confirmed that Festival of the Lion King at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park will be moving to that new theater in Africa we recently posted about and stated that the new theater will open sometime in 2014.     Construction Has Begun on New Home for Festival of the Lion King

    Behind Tusker House in Africa at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park, construction has begun on a new home for Festival of the Lion King.
